WebGestalt therapy is often more action-oriented, with therapists using a variety of experiential modalities to help clients explore and integrate the impact of their experiences and emotions. Existential therapy, on the other hand, emphasizes client engagement in speech and thought, as well as inquiry into how individuals feel and think. This web of ... WebOverall, Gestalt therapy emphasizes the importance of awareness, the here-and-now experiencing, and staying with the feeling. It also recognizes the role of resistances to contact, catastrophic expectations, and impasses or stuck points in the therapeutic process.
